Transaction 8e72d52405aaabbec8374ae590ab2a589d9e734c4f59d2c9fae152832ba9def8
2 Input
2 Outputs
- 8e72d52405aaabbec8374ae590ab2a589d9e734c4f59d2c9fae152832ba9def8:0
- 8e72d52405aaabbec8374ae590ab2a589d9e734c4f59d2c9fae152832ba9def8:1
value 32249
address 1JUfPfhwtpPSMQGjmNhSierFeUvmt3ehrH
value 153611
address 384Ks27JWu98FpHDqpTx5JQ7kZH1gXJQkZ